NAUGATUCK — The Zoning Commission has set a hearing on a special permit application for a new car wash on New Haven Road for its July 17 meeting.

The commission in June accepted the application from Dan Camacho of Naugatuck and referred it to the Planning Commission. According to the application, the plan is to demolish a residential building that is in disrepair at 1015 New Haven Road and build a car wash on the 0.72-acre lot, which is at the corner of Weid Drive and New Haven Road.

The land is in the New Haven Road Design District, which was created in 2007 in order to promote mixed-use development in the district.

The site plan shows the exit and entrance to the car wash will be on New Haven Road. The application states the car wash would take six months to build and the project is estimated to cost $875,000. The car wash would be open from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. and have five employees, the application states.
